Minutes — Vexhall Trading management meeting. Attendees: Pryde, Omelan, Castagne. Agreed: hedge 70% of kroner exposure through Q3 via forward contracts; remainder floats. Treasury to execute by month-end. Branch managers must not adjust local pricing pending further notice. Omelan to circulate revised FX guidance Friday. The confidential note below outlines the rationale and next steps.

internal memo for yahag-tahog: The pricing group signed off on a budget of $152.8 million for Project Soriel.

## Session Handling for Health Checks

The Corvel gateway sits behind the Lanternside load balancer, which probes /healthz every ten seconds. Health-check requests are stateless by design: they bypass the session store entirely so that probe traffic never inflates session counts or evicts real user sessions. New team members should note that the deep-check endpoint, /healthz/deep, does verify session-store connectivity and therefore requires authentication. When probing it manually, supply the token below.

bearer token for tajep-kajef: eyJhbGciOiJIUzI1NiIsInR5cCI6IkpXVCJ9.eyJzdWIiOiIoOsZ23In0.CsygO0hs

## Who to Contact: SDK Parity

The Corvalle platform ships two client SDKs, Lanternjs and Lanternkt. Feature parity is tracked in the shared parity matrix on this wiki; discrepancies found in customer tickets should be logged there first, with a reproduction case attached. For anything urgent or ambiguous, reach the SDK working group at the address below.

escalation mailbox, hadug-bajog: sormir@norvalabs.internal

Handover — Quellis nightly search reindex (from Darven to Ilsa)

Plugin authors should note the reindex job now runs in two passes: a tokenizer sweep at 01:00, then segment merges at 02:30. Custom analyzers registered via the Quellis plugin API are reloaded between passes, so avoid caching analyzer handles across runs. Crash recovery resumes from the last committed shard checkpoint. The runtime reads the following settings at startup.

settings of yaguf-bahip:
druwyn:
  log_level: debug
  metrics_host: metrics.druwyn.qorvelsys.internal
  pool_size: 32